P. LEAGUE+ & T1 LEAGUE/Lin Wei-han named T1 League MVP for December

New Taipei CTBC DEA point guard Lin Wei-han (???) was named the T1 MVP of the Month for December for the first time, while his teammate Edgaras Zelionis was named T1 Import of the Month, the six-team T1 LEAGUE announced Tuesday.

Lin, 32, averaged 17.7 points, 6.7 rebounds, and 12 assists in his three games last month, including one game with 18 points, 11 boards, and 12 dimes against the Taoyuan Leopards, making him the first player to achieve at least one triple double in Taiwan's Super Basketball League (SBL), China's Chinese Basketball Association (CBA) and T1.

The triple double came six days after one by Lee Han-sheng (???) of the Tainan TSG GhostHawks, the first triple double recorded by a local player in the league, but Lin was the first to make the achievement in regular time.

Zelionis, who is from Lithuania, was recognized as the best import player for achieving an average of 20.6 points and 11.8 rebounds per game in the DEA's five games last month.

Zelionis had not previously won the award.

The on court performances by Lin and Zelionis played an important part in securing the DEA's 5-0 record in December.

Dreamers appoint new head coach

Meanwhile, the Formosa Taishin Dreamers in the P. LEAGUE+ (PLG), the other six-team professional basketball league in Taiwan, parted ways with their Canadian head coach Kyle Julius, the team said via its Facebook and Instagram pages Tuesday.

The Dreamers thanked Julius for his hard work over the past few years. He was appointed the Dreamers' head coach in August 2019, after which he agreed a three-year extension contract from the PLG's inaugural 2020-21 season.

The Dreamers announced that assistant coach Eric Lai (???) will be their new head coach.
